Planning appeal decision

Dismissed18 February 20266001527

Land Adjacent to 1 Toad Carr, Ferney Lee Road, Todmorden, West Yorkshire, OL14 5JA

outline application for a new dwelling - all matters reserved

Authority
Calderdale Metropolitan Borough Council
Appeal type
minor · Planning Appeal
Procedure
Written Representations
Development
residential · Minor Dwellings
Inspector
Wilson L

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The effect of the proposed development on the living conditions of the occupiers of nearby dwellings and whether the proposed development would provide acceptable living conditions for future occupiers, with particular reference to privacy
  • Whether adequate details relating to drainage have been provided
  • The effect of the proposed development on the character and appearance of the surrounding area, including the setting of the Todmorden Conservation Area

What decided it

The site's severe physical constraints, particularly its limited size and relationship with multiple neighbouring properties at different levels, make it impossible to accommodate a dwelling that would meet the Council's separation distance standards and avoid unacceptable harm to neighbours' privacy and future occupiers' living conditions.

The adverse impacts of harm to living conditions and unacceptable drainage risk significantly and demonstrably outweigh the benefits of providing one additional dwelling, such that the presumption in favour of sustainable development does not apply despite the Council's inability to demonstrate a five-year housing land supply.
